The Role
This is a fantastic opportunity to step into a hybrid Applications / Technical Sales Engineering role, where you will act as the link between customers, sales and engineering teams. You will be:
- Supporting customers with technical enquiries and product selection
- Producing quotes and proposals for a range of engineering solutions
- Working on projects ranging from standard products to bespoke engineered systems
- Collaborating with internal engineering teams to develop tailored solutions
- Building your commercial awareness in a consultative, customer-facing environment
This role offers a unique blend of hands-on engineering knowledge and commercial exposure, ideal for someone looking to broaden their career beyond pure design or manufacturing.
